Surround Yourself With Mentors
Picking up a quick job that pays you by the hour is great, but don’t forget about how important it is to set your foundation so that you continue to make money throughout your career. Finding older professionals who can mentor you through your internship wins and challenges helps you build a support system that is crucial for a high-achieving person who wants to make a lot of money. “A mentor is invaluable,” Golden explains. “You can bounce ideas off of your mentor, whether it’s about potentially changing your major or searching for work opportunities.” A mentor could even help you figure out exactly what salary to ask for so that you don’t get underpaid or accidentally sell yourself short.
Mentors can also assist you if you’re hoping to break glass ceilings in a challenging field, like entering a male-dominated field as a girl. “Women, on average, get paid 80 cents to a man’s dollar,” noted Schwab. “So find women that inspire you. Speaking to your mom or your mom’s friends or your friends’ moms about their careers, I think you’ll find that you’ll be very inspired. They’re all so powerful in their own right.”
Video Production And Editing

Businesses and entrepreneurs are using the power of video to engage their audiences more than ever before.
So the need for video production and editing will only keep rising in demand.
That also means that experts in this field can earn good money either within a company or agency or for yourself as a freelancer.
The average salary for a video editor in the US is around $53,000.
Freelancers on Upwork are making between $20 and $50 per hour.
To become a video editor, you’ll need to learn how to use software tools such as Adobe Premier Pro or Final Cut Pro on Macs.
Some editors also learn how to create special effects to make their creations really stand out.
Luckily, there are dozens of YouTubers teaching how to use these tools so that you can become an editor yourself.
To dive into this skill further, it’s highly recommended to enroll in an online course where the instructor will guide you step by step.

Web Development And Web Design
Building websites for businesses is a common way for people to make money online.
It’s also one of the easier skills to learn to start an online business. That’s because technology has come a long way in this industry.
Many people get into web development by watching tutorials on YouTube, then building sites for their friends or relatives.
Other ways to make money as a web designer and developer are through freelancing sites such as Upwork or Fiverr.
If you want to work for a company, you might need formal training or a certification, depending on where you live. Otherwise, you’ll need a decent portfolio and experience to land a high-paying job.
Web developers can expect to make around $77,200 on average working within an agency.
And freelance web developers are making anywhere between $45 to $120+.
To get started in this field, watch some tutorials or take an online course. The best way to learn with web design and development is through practice.
Build your own sites or build up a portfolio for local businesses.

What Is An Easy Job
Before we dig into the easy high paying jobs you might want to consider, lets pause for a moment and take a look at what an easy job actually is. First, a position doesnt have to be boring or unchallenging to be easy. Second, it doesnt have to be entirely stress-free, either.
Generally, easy job is a subjective term. It could mean that you enjoy the work, so you dont find it stressful. Or it could mean that it doesnt require a ton of specialized training, making it an option for nearly anyone. In some cases, it could be that handling the duties feels natural and comfortable.
For the purpose of this list, an easy job is one that is reasonably low-stress and that many people find fun. That can make the work feel manageable and enjoyable, which are often key components to what people view as easy.

Computer System And It Manager
A computer system manager or IT manager will oversee all computer related systems and processes in a company or organization. This can include things like planning out hardware purchases, installing computing software, managing a network, and performing troubleshooting. IT managers need quite a bit of education, including ongoing education, to stay up to date on new techniques and tech products.
- Requirements: Bachelors degree or masters degree, ongoing education
- Average annual salary: $142,530
- Top annual earners: $500,000 plus
- The downside: Can require long working hours, extensive education, and rare to reach a seven figure salary

The Trouble With Many Conventional Degrees
Many traditional four-year degrees aren’t all they’re cracked up to be. For example, a 2022 labor market study shows that, on average, people with bachelor’s degrees in majors like education and the humanities have some of the lowest earnings of all their peers.
According to a 2019 NCES employment report, more than half of college graduates with a traditional bachelor’s degree in science, technology, engineering, or math are not employed in the fields they studied. Science majors often have difficulty finding work in their fields. In many cases, success in these areas requires spending additional time in school to earn master’s or doctorate degrees.
The result is that many college graduates who choose the conventional route end up underemployed in jobs like retail or food service. Those who major in science or the liberal arts are especially vulnerable unless they go on to graduate school to increase their opportunities. According to numbers from the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ics program, the median annual wage of a retail salesperson in the U.S. was only $29,120. For cashiers, it was even less: $27,260.
Whether traditional college is worth the time and investment often depends on the career you want. You will need to discover if you can achieve your goals without a degree. Often, training at a vocational school is what you need.
